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8748668452 296336345 0887 2506
0162957718 90 927
0162957718 90 927
3230675905 573 97206560412
All about undefined
Interested in learning more?
0162957718 90 927
3230675905 573 97206560412
See more
49 19244615500
836550653 01272 081 85920
See more
04 272243 1773090
40126 89835 842
See more